XHProf DifferentialDiff::buildChangesetsFromRawChanges Profile

XHProf Profile

SymbolCountWall Time%
Metrics for this Call
DifferentialDiff::buildChangesetsFromRawChanges1678 us100.0%
Parent Calls
DifferentialDiff::newEphemeralFromRawChanges1678 us
Child Calls
spl_autoload_call2176 us26.0%
DifferentialChangesetEngine::rebuildChangesets1146 us21.5%
DifferentialDiff::setLineCount1111 us16.4%
DifferentialChangeset::setOldFile1103 us15.2%
DifferentialChangeset::setAddLines18 us1.2%
DifferentialChangeset::setFilename17 us1.0%
DifferentialChangeset::setChangeType16 us0.9%
DifferentialChangeset::setFileType16 us0.9%
DifferentialChangeset::setOldProperties16 us0.9%
DifferentialChangeset::setNewProperties16 us0.9%
DifferentialChangeset::setMetadata16 us0.9%
DifferentialChangeset::setAwayPaths16 us0.9%
DifferentialChangeset::setDelLines16 us0.9%
DifferentialDiff::attachChangesets13 us0.4%
DifferentialChangeset::attachHunks13 us0.4%
DifferentialDiff::addUnsavedChangeset12 us0.3%
DifferentialDiff::getChangesets12 us0.3%
LiskDAO::__construct11 us0.1%
ArcanistDiffChange::getType20 us
ArcanistDiffChange::getCurrentPath10 us
ArcanistDiffChange::getNewProperties10 us
ArcanistDiffChange::getOldPath10 us
ArcanistDiffChange::getAllMetadata10 us
ArcanistDiffChange::getOldProperties10 us
ArcanistDiffChange::getHunks10 us
id10 us
ArcanistDiffChange::getFileType10 us
ArcanistDiffChange::getAwayPaths10 us